The assertion that biofilms are highly susceptible to the body's defense mechanisms is not accurate. In reality, biofilms are known for their resilience and ability to protect the microorganisms within them from both the host's immune system and various forms of treatment, such as antibiotics.

Biofilms consist of complex communities of microorganisms that adhere to surfaces and are encased in a protective matrix. This matrix can make it challenging for the body's immune cells to penetrate and effectively combat these microorganisms. Furthermore, the bacteria within biofilms can exhibit a range of metabolic states, some of which may be more resistant to immune responses.

In contrast, the correct understanding of biofilms highlights their notable resistance to treatments, including antibiotics, due to the protective structure. While they can contribute to infections and other issues, their capability to withstand disinfection processes and rough treatment by the immune system is why they are often associated with chronic infections and treated as a significant concern in both medical and environmental settings.
